Fiber co-location (fiber colo) is a colocation service that’s specifically designed around fiber connectivity: a provider lets customers place their networking/optical equipment (routers, switches, DWDM gear, OLTs, firewalls, etc.) inside a secure facility that is already connected to one or more fiber networks, so they can interconnect quickly and cheaply.

In practice, it’s usually one of these “fiber-adjacent” sites:

  • A carrier-neutral data center / “carrier hotel” where many carriers and customers interconnect. Colocation here means renting space (rack/cage), with power/cooling/security, while keeping control of your own gear. (Corning)
  • A fiber provider’s POP / central office / edge facility (sometimes called a “network hut” or “regeneration site”) where the provider has fiber aggregation equipment—and can rent rack space plus fiber access.
  • A site with a Meet-Me Room (MMR): a secure room where carriers and tenants physically cross-connect fiber to exchange traffic. (Corning)

How it works (simple flow)

  1. You rent space + power in the fiber colo site (rack units, cabinet, cage, or suite). (Corning)
  2. The provider offers fiber cross-connects (patching your rack to their fiber / other carriers in the MMR). (Corning)
  3. You can then:
    • connect to multiple carriers/ISPs (for redundancy or better pricing),
    • connect into cloud on-ramps (in many data centers),
    • or light leased dark fiber by installing your own optics at the endpoints. (Dark fiber = installed but unused/unlit fiber strands that can be leased.) (Lumen Blog)

What makes it “fiber” colocation (vs regular colocation)

Regular IT colocation focuses on “a place to put servers.”
Fiber co-location focuses on “a place to put network gear where fiber is already present,” so the real value is interconnection density + proximity to fiber routes/POPs (lower latency, faster provisioning, fewer construction permits).

Why it matters for your topic (revenue from existing resources)

If you already own fiber routes + POPs/rooms/space, “fiber co-location” can monetize what you have by selling:

  • Space/power (rack, cabinet, cage)
  • Cross-connect fees (one-time install + monthly)
  • Interconnection bundles (to carriers, IXPs, enterprise buildings)
  • Add-ons like remote hands, managed patching, monitoring
